I'd like to modify a remote TV control. Put a small microphone on it
with a volume control and an LED indicator plus a small timing circuit.
You would use the volume control to set the current speaker level with
the LED indicator and just back it off a touch. When the loud commercial
comes on the LED blinks, auto mutes the TV with the mute button and
starts the timer for 60 seconds. After 60 seconds the mute button is hit
again and sound comes back on. If the sound is still above set level it
mutes another 30 seconds and continues this until the sound returns to
normal levels.

There must be enough off-the-shelf stuff to do this with and have it fit
inside the remote. You think?
